Best time to go to Dolphin

The best time to visit Dolphin is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January39.9°F (4.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
May51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July59.5°F (15.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August59.0°F (15.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
September55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October51.3°F (10.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
November45.5°F (7.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Dolphin

To reach Dolphin, Wales, you have several airport options. Manchester Airport (MAN) is situated 62.8km away, with nearby luxurious hotels like Kimpton Clocktower by IHG, The Edwardian Manchester, and The Lowry Hotel, all 12.9km from the airport. Liverpool John Lennon Airport (LPL) is closer at 25.7km, offering excellent lodgings such as The Chester Grosvenor, Mere Brook House, and Stone Villa. Chester Hawarden Airport (CEG) is the nearest at 17.7km, with quality accommodation options like The Hotel Chester and Grosvenor Pulford Hotel & Spa, both just 6.4km away. Each airport provides convenient transport services to ensure a smooth arrival.
